What is a professional wood chipping service?

A professional wood chipping service uses commercial-grade drum or disc chippers to process branches, brush, limbs, and tree debris into uniform wood chips on-site. The resulting chips can be hauled away by the service crew, left on the property for use as mulch or ground cover, or spread across designated areas as part of a broader tree care or land management job. Commercial chippers process material far faster and more completely than rental units available to homeowners.

How Does a Wood Chipping Service Work in Connecticut?

Here is what to expect when Erick’s Tree Services performs a wood chipping job on your Connecticut property:


Free On-Site Estimate — We assess the volume and type of material to be chipped, confirm access for the chipper and truck, and discuss whether chips will be left on-site or hauled away. You receive a written quote before any work begins.


Equipment Setup — The chipper is positioned at the most efficient access point — typically at the end of a driveway or as close to the material as vehicle access allows. For material in fenced yards or areas with limited access, we carry or wheel material to the chipper rather than driving equipment through the yard.


Systematic Chipping — The crew feeds material into the chipper in order of accessibility, typically working from the largest pile closest to the chipper outward. Branches are fed butt-end first for the most efficient processing and cleanest chip output.


Chip Management — Chips are directed into the chipper’s discharge chute toward the chip truck for hauling, or redirected to the ground for on-site spreading, depending on the agreed plan. For spreading jobs, we move the chip pile to the designated areas before it builds up.


Cleanup — After all material is processed, the area where the piles were is raked and blown clean. Chip debris on driveways, walkways, and adjacent lawn is removed. The property is left clean and clear before we depart.


Chip Spreading (if included) — If chips are being spread rather than hauled, we spread them to the agreed depth across the designated areas mulch rings, garden beds, paths, or ground cover areas before cleanup.

What Does Wood Chipping Cost in Connecticut?

Wood chipping in Connecticut is typically priced by the volume of material, assessed during the on-site estimate, or by the hour for large or ongoing jobs.


Ways to reduce your wood chipping cost:

  • Keep chips on your property — hauling chips off-site adds a load cost per truck; keeping them for mulch or path material eliminates that cost entirely
  • Bundle with tree or land services — chipping included as part of a removal, pruning, or clearing job is always more cost-effective than a separate standalone visit
  • Organize material before we arrive — piles consolidated and accessible near the driveway or street require less crew time to process than material scattered across the property

How much does wood chipping cost in Connecticut?

Wood chipping in Connecticut typically costs $150–$350 for small piles taking one to two hours, $350–$700 for medium-volume half-day jobs, and $700–$1,500 for large full-day chipping projects. Post-storm large debris events run $500–$2,000 depending on volume. Chip hauling off-site adds $150–$400 per load. Keeping chips on-site for mulch eliminates hauling cost entirely. We provide free on-site written estimates for all chipping jobs.

Is it better to keep wood chips or have them hauled away?

It depends on how much material your property can usefully absorb. Wood chips are excellent mulch for tree root zones, garden beds, and paths, keeping them eliminates hauling cost and puts the material to productive use. However, if the volume exceeds what your site needs, the chips are from a diseased tree, or you are preparing the area for construction or lawn installation, hauling them away is the right choice. What size branches can you chip?

Our commercial chippers handle branches up to 12 inches in diameter, significantly larger than the 4 to 6 inch capacity of most rental units available to homeowners. For trunk sections above that diameter, we cut them to rounds before the chipping visit or process them separately. Is renting a chipper better than hiring a wood chipping service?

For most residential jobs in Connecticut, hiring a professional service is more cost-effective and safer than renting. Rental chippers are limited to 4–6 inch branch diameter, require significant operator effort, and leave chip disposal to you. Professional chippers process larger material faster, the crew handles all labor and cleanup, and chips are hauled away if you don’t want them. The combined cost of rental, fuel, disposal fees, and your time typically exceeds the cost of professional service for anything beyond a very small pile.

Can you chip material from diseased trees?

Yes, with caveats. Most wood-rotting fungi and common tree diseases do not survive the chipping process at commercial chipper speeds. However, chips from trees with certain fungal diseases, particularly Armillaria root rot or trees with known soil-borne pathogens, should not be spread near healthy trees or used as garden mulch. We will flag this during the estimate if the material appears to be from a diseased tree and recommend hauling rather than spreading for those specific piles.
